A Huntingburg man was taken into custody Friday night after police responded to a report of a domestic battery incident.

According to responding officers, a female plaintiff was transported to Memorial Hospital and Health Care Center for chest pain.

The suspect, 34-year-old Balmer E. Salazar, reportedly left on foot but was later located returning to the scene.

Salazar was booked into the Dubois County Security Center early Saturday morning on preliminary misdemeanor counts of domestic battery and resisting law enforcement.
